IBCC.DE vs. QDVE.DE
IBCC.DE (iShares $ Treasury Bond 0-1yr UCITS ETF USD (Dist)) and QDVE.DE (iShares S&P 500 Information Technology Sector UCITS 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- IBCC.DE is a Government Bonds fund tracking the ICE US Treasury Short Bond Index, while QDVE.DE is a Technology Equities fund tracking the S&P 500 Capped 35/20 Information Technology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, IBCC.DE returned 4.17%/yr vs 22.04%/yr for QDVE.DE. At a 0.06 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. IBCC.DE charges 0.07%/yr vs 0.15%/yr for QDVE.DE.
